This includes … Webb6 maj 2024 · When dealing with an existing scleral buckle, or when putting on a buckle at the time of the glaucoma surgery, a low-profile implant like a Baerveldt is a good choice. Its thin and flexible plate is preferred for inserting over a scleral encircling band. It’s best to suture it directly to the upper surface of the scleral buckling element.

Webb4 maj 2024 · It works by pushing and holding the retina in position from the inside. This is different from scleral buckle surgery in which the eye wall in indented to push it against the retina from the outside. Depending on the characteristics of a retinal detachment, during vitrectomy surgery silicone oil or gas may be used to hold the retina in place. WebbRecovery after Scleral Buckling Surgery. After undergoing scleral buckling surgery, patients are typically seen 1 day, 1 week, and 1 month following their surgery for post-operative appointments with a retinal specialist at Calgary Retina Consultants.
